Council approves phase 2 PD amendment for Main Street Town Crossing, keeps elevation review for large-format store

City of Midlothian City Council · February 10, 2026

Council approved a Planned Development amendment for phase 2 of the Main Street Town Crossing project, endorsed variances for signage and parking, and struck language that would have removed council-level elevation review for large-format retail — preserving council oversight of major building façades.

The City Council voted Feb. 10 to amend the Planned Development (PD 171) ordinance governing phase 2 of the Main Street Town Crossing project, approving requested variances for signage and parking while preserving the council’s ability to review elevations for large-format buildings.
